Biography of Mike Tyson
Mike Tyson, born on June 30, 1966, in Brooklyn, New York, rose to fame as a professional boxer and is widely regarded as one of the greatest heavyweights of all time. His career began at a young age, and by the age of 20, he became the youngest heavyweight champion in history. Tyson’s aggressive style, speed, and power made him a formidable opponent in the ring, earning him numerous titles and accolades.
Throughout his career, Tyson experienced both tremendous success and significant challenges, including legal issues and personal struggles. Despite these obstacles, his legacy as a boxing icon remains intact, and he continues to be a prominent figure in sports even after his retirement.

History of Autograph Cards
Autograph cards have a long history in the world of sports memorabilia. These cards serve as a tangible connection to athletes, preserving their legacy for fans and collectors. The practice of collecting autographs dates back to the early 20th century, but it gained immense popularity in the late 1980s and 1990s with the rise of trading cards.
Mike Tyson's autograph cards emerged during this boom, capturing the interest of boxing fans in particular. The combination of Tyson's dynamic personality and his impressive boxing record made his autograph cards highly sought after.
Value of Mike Tyson Autograph Cards
The value of Mike Tyson autograph cards can vary significantly based on several factors, including the card's condition, rarity, and authenticity. Here are some key aspects that influence the value:
- Condition: Cards in mint or near-mint condition fetch higher prices.
- Rarity: Limited edition or specially released cards are often more valuable.
- Authentication: Cards that come with a certificate of authenticity are usually valued higher.
- Market Demand: Current trends in the collectible market can affect value.
As of recent years, some Mike Tyson autograph cards have sold for thousands of dollars at auction, demonstrating the enduring appeal of this boxing legend.
Authenticating Mike Tyson Autograph Cards
Ensuring the authenticity of a Mike Tyson autograph card is crucial for collectors. Here are some steps to authenticate your card:
- Research: Familiarize yourself with Mike Tyson's signature style by comparing it to verified examples.
- Certificates of Authenticity: Always seek cards that come with a reputable certificate of authenticity from recognized organizations.
- Professional Appraisal: Consider having the card evaluated by a professional appraiser specializing in sports memorabilia.
Where to Buy Mike Tyson Autograph Cards
If you're looking to add a Mike Tyson autograph card to your collection, there are several places to consider:
- Online Auctions: Websites like eBay frequently feature listings for Mike Tyson autograph cards.
- Sports Memorabilia Shops: Specialized shops often carry a selection of autograph cards.
- Collector Shows: Attending sports memorabilia shows can provide opportunities to buy, sell, and trade cards.
- Online Marketplaces: Platforms like Beckett and COMC offer a range of collectible cards.
